
Everybody Hates Chris
“Everybody Hates Chris” is an American television sitcom that humorously portrays the challenging teenage years of comedian Chris Rock as he grew up in Bedford-Stuyvesant, Brooklyn, New York City. The series is set between 1982 and 1987, although Rock’s actual teenage years spanned from 1978 to 1983. Rock’s childhood friend, Kenny Montero, served as a significant inspiration for many of the show’s episodes, with Rock often crediting Kenny as the catalyst for his career in comedy. The title of the show is a playful twist on the popular CBS sitcom “Everybody Loves Raymond,” with Rock humorously noting, “Everybody Loves Raymond, but Everybody Hates Chris!” The main cast includes Tyler James Williams, Terry Crews, Tichina Arnold, Tequan Richmond, Imani Hakim, and Vincent Martella.
In 2008, The CW network shifted “Everybody Hates Chris” and “The Game” to the less favorable Friday night time slot. The fourth season of “Everybody Hates Chris” debuted on Friday, October 3, 2008, at 8:00 PM Eastern/7:00 PM Central. On May 21, 2009, The CW announced the cancellation of the series. Prior to this announcement, Rock had indicated that the conclusion of the fourth season aligned with his own life story—leaving high school to pursue a career in comedy—and that it was an appropriate time to wrap up the show.
